Every month, you receive a new video module, where I paint or draw a horse step by step, sharing my tips and techniques.
Modules are added to a living library that grows month by month, becoming a rich archive of exercises over time.
Follow the monthly rhythm or explore freely at your own pace.
➕ Each module includes a reference photo to guide your practice.
✨ Bonus materials are regularly added, giving you extra inspiration, tips, or exercises to deepen your skills.
💬 Join our private community to share your work, get feedback, and connect with fellow artists.
You can join at any time — and grow with the course as new modules are added.
This course is designed to stay alive and responsive.
Working month by month allows me to stay connected with you, respond to your questions, and adapt the content as the course unfolds. If a topic or difficulty comes up repeatedly, it can become a new exercise or a bonus lesson.
It also creates a sense of continuity and shared momentum, even if everyone joins at a different time. Rather than rushing through content, you’re invited to explore, practice, and let things settle at your own pace.

Each month, you’ll receive a complete video lesson focused on a specific theme. I’ll guide you to help you explore gesture, movement, and emotion through expressive drawing and painting.
One or two additional videos will be added during the month — short demonstrations or inspirations to keep you progressing with pleasure and curiosity.
A carefully selected photo reference of a horse will accompany each month’s lesson, allowing you to practice and deepen your understanding of the subject.
Instant access to all previous lessons, so you can learn and revisit each module at your own pace.
Share your progress, ask questions, and connect with other passionate artists on our dedicated Discord space. You’re not alone on this journey!
